What they do
A Help Desk Technician or Analyst provides technical support to computer users. Handles customer inquiries and works to resolve technical issues with computer hardware, software or networks. Provides customer support by phone, email, live chat or with screen sharing. May refer customers with complex system or application problems for more advanced technical support. Tracks help requests using a ticketing system.

East Texas Electric Cooperative, Inc. (ETEC) is an electric cooperative headquartered in Nacogdoches, Texas. ETEC generates and transmits wholesale electricity to nine distribution cooperatives that reach over 300,000 homes and businesses. ETEC serves load in the Southwest Power Pool (SPP), the Midcontinent Independent System Operator (MISO) as well as the Electric Reliability Council of Texas (ERCOT) regions.
